STK, Ascenza Reach Distribution Agreement For Regev Fungicide

STK bio–ag technologies, an Israeli bio-ag technology company for sustainable agriculture, and Ascenza have announced an exclusive agreement for the distribution of the “hybrid” fungicide Regev throughout Mexico. SEG Donates 1.12M Meals To Support Hunger Action Month

Jacksonville, Florida-based Southeastern Grocers, parent company and home of BI-LO, Fresco y Más, Harveys Supermarket and Winn-Dixie grocery stores, together with the SEG Gives Foundation, is donating 1,125,000 meals to Feeding America in support of Hunger Action Month and the organization’s efforts to end hunger. Smithfield Foods To Become Carbon Negative By 2030

Smithfield Foods became the first major protein company to commit to becoming carbon negative in all company-owned operations in the United States by 2030. New Walmart Health Opens At Newnan Supercenter In Georgia

A new Walmart Health center recently opened at 1025 Bullsboro Drive, Newnan, Georgia, adjacent to the Supercenter. The modern facility provides quality, affordable and accessible healthcare for members of the Newnan community. This Newnan location is the fifth Walmart Health location the retailer has opened. People Magazine Ranks Publix No. 1 On 50 Companies That Care List

Lakeland, Florida-based Publix has been recognized as the No. 1 company that cares by People magazine. The fourth annual list will be featured in the Sept. 14 issue of the magazine, which will be on newsstands nationwide Sept. 4. Georgia Trend Honors Parker’s Founder/CEO As 2020 Legacy Leader

Georgia Trend magazine has honored Parker’s founder and CEO Greg Parker as a “Legacy Leader” in the September 2020 issue. SOUTHEAST: Southeastern Grocers Selling 23 BI-LO And Harveys Stores

Jacksonville, Florida-based Southeastern Grocers, parent company of BI-LO, Fresco y Más, Harveys Supermarket and Winn-Dixie stores, said Sept. 1 it has reached an agreement to sell 23 total stores: 20 BI-LO stores to Alex Lee Inc., and two BI-LO stores and one Harveys Supermarket to B&T Foods.
